How To Fix RS_B4H_PREPARE_APD006 - Nothing was changed


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: RS_B4H_PREPARE_APD - Message class for APD transfer prepare package

  • Message number: 006

  • Message text: Nothing was changed

    The SAP error message RS_B4H_PREPARE_APD006: "Nothing was changed" typically occurs in the context of SAP BW (Business Warehouse) when working with the Analysis Process Designer (APD) or when executing a data flow that involves data extraction or transformation processes. This error indicates that the system did not find any changes to process, which can happen for several reasons.

    Possible Causes:

    1. No New Data: The source data might not have changed since the last execution, leading to no new records being available for processing.
    2. Selection Criteria: The selection criteria defined in the APD might be too restrictive, resulting in no data being selected for processing.
    3. Data Source Issues: There could be issues with the data source, such as connectivity problems or incorrect configurations.
    4. Execution Context: The execution context might not be set up correctly, leading to the system not recognizing any changes.
    5. Data Load Status: The data load status might indicate that the data has already been processed, and there are no new records to load.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Data Source: Verify that the data source has new data available. You can do this by checking the underlying tables or data sources.
    2. Review Selection Criteria: Examine the selection criteria in the APD to ensure they are correctly set and not overly restrictive.
    3. Re-run Data Load: If the data source has been updated, try re-running the data load process to see if the error persists.
    4. Check Execution Logs: Review the execution logs for any additional error messages or warnings that might provide more context about the issue.
    5. Test with Different Parameters: If applicable, test the APD with different parameters or settings to see if it yields different results.
    6.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ific version of BW you are using for any known issues or patches.
